The Royal Ballet is an internationally renowned classical ballet company, based at the Royal Opera House in Covent Garden, London, UK.The largest of the four major ballet companies in Great Britain, the Royal Ballet was founded in 1931 by Dame Ninette de Valois, it became the resident ballet company of the Royal Opera House in 1946 and was granted a royal charter in 1956, becoming … But there is much more going on than meets the eye in the often misunderstood ballet world. Billy Elliot is a 2000 British dance drama film directed by Stephen Daldry and written by Lee Hall.Set in County Durham, England during the 1984–85 miners' strike, the film is about a working-class boy who discovers his passion for ballet, despite his father's objection and the negative stereotype associated with being a male ballet dancer. Ninette De Valois founded the school in 1926 with the opening of the Academy of Choreographic Art, which was renamed the Vic-Wells Ballet School in 1931, and again renamed in 1939 to The Sadler’s Wells Ballet School.
